California health insurance rebate checks to be mailed out next week

Health Insurance Refund

Many policyholders in the state will be receiving money back due to the Affordable Care Act. President Obama’s overhaul of the medical care system will be providing many California health insurance policyholders with rebate checks, starting next week, as their insurers pay them back for failing to spend their earnings according to the new law’s requirements. Approximately 1.8 million people in the state will be receiving money back. These rebates will be either in the form of a reduction in their monthly premiums, or in the form of a check…

California health insurance rebates to be sent out to small businesses

Health Insurance Refund

UnitedHealth is expected to issue $3.5 million in these refunds California health insurance giant, UnitedHealth, is the first in the state to declare the total amount in rebates that it will be issuing to small businesses due to the fact that its spending on medical care costs did not reach the 80 percent requirement under the healthcare reform laws. There will be approximately $3.5 million split among almost 4,400 small business across the state. The rebates will be received throughout the summer as the insurer also gets itself ready to…
